Population Overview
Fort Jennings village is a small community located in Ohio. The total population is 467. It ranks as the 905th most populous out of 1,264 cities and towns in Ohio.
Age Demographics
The median age in Fort Jennings village is 50.7 years. This is 28% higher than the state median of 39.6 years. 12.0% of residents are 75 or older, suggesting a significant retirement-age population with implications for healthcare services and senior housing.
Economy, Income & Housing
The median household income in Fort Jennings village is $64,375. This is 8% lower than the state median of $69,680.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 18% lower. The poverty rate stands at 10.3%. This is 22% lower than the state poverty rate of 13.2%. The unemployment rate is 2.3%. This is 53% lower than the state rate of 4.9%. The median home value is $204,200. Housing costs are 3% higher than the state median of $199,200. The home-value-to-income ratio is 3.2x. 81.2%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 21% higher than the state average of 67.0%.
Race & Ethnicity
Fort Jennings village has a predominantly White (non-Hispanic) population, comprising 93.2% of all residents. Black or African American residents account for 2.8%. The Black or African American population (2.8%) is well below the state average of 12.1%. The Hispanic or Latino population (2.1%) is well below the state average of 4.6%.
Education
17.4%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 44% lower than the state rate of 30.9%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 97.9%.
Data Sources & Methodology
All demographic data for Fort Jennings village, Ohio is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against Ohio state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 1,264 Census-designated places in Ohio.
